Portland Trail Blazers vs. New Orleans Pelicans Prediction, Preview, and Odds – 3-12-2023

The New Orleans Pelicans host the Portland Trail Blazers Sunday night in a key battle between two teams looking to sneak into the Western Conference playoffs. The Pelicans hold the 10th and final playoff spot in the conference while the Blazers are in 13th place, but only 1.5 games behind New Orleans. These two rivals have split two games this season, with the road team winning both. Tipoff is at 7:00 p.m. EST at the Smoothie King Center in New Orleans.

The Blazers are 13th in the Western Conference with a record of 31-36. They are wrapping up a tough road trip where they are 2-3, but have played pretty well. On Friday night they lost a heartbreaker to the Philadelphia 76ers by the score of 120-119. They were done in by MVP candidate and the NBA's leading scorer, Joel Embiid, who hit the game winning fade away jumper with 1.1 seconds left. That was game time, not Dame time.

Embiid had a stellar game, leading all scorers with 39 points. Anfernee Simons returned from injury and had a great game as well, dropping 34 points on 8 of 12 shooting from three point range. Jerami Grant added 24 points and 10 rebounds while Damian Lillard tossed in 22 points and dished out 11 assists. The Blazers shot 52% from the floor and made 15 threes, but it was not enough.
